Composite Clock Output Module

This section provides user-reference data for the Composite Clock Output module
(part number 23413279-000-0) used in both the SSU-2000e main chassis and in
the optional SDU-2000e expansion shelf.
Composite Clock Output Module Overview
The Composite Clock Output module generates 20 signal pairs (TTIP and TRING
signal pairs). Each output is a transformer-coupled symmetrical pair. Each output
pair can be turned off independently of other channels; relays on each output allow
for disconnecting the driver output from the output pins. These outputs are
independently configurable for duty cycle (50/50 or 62.5/37.5) and phase delay from

The outputs are byte and polarity phase aligned with the selected 4 kHz clock. Each
output signal is monitored for a failed output on an independent basis. An output is
said to be failed when either the polarity pulse falls below 2.1 volts base to peak,
when polarity reversal can no longer be detected, or when return to zero cannot be
detected.
The outputs of the Composite Clock Output module meet the criteria set forth in
Bellcore GR-378-CORE and TR-TSY-000458 for signal type, amplitude, and
waveshape. ITU-T Rec. G.703 Centralized Clock is partially supported (50/50 duty
cycle) except only the Bellcore signal levels are generated.
Note: External, customer-supplied padding can be affixed to
attenuate the output level to meet Composite Clock specifications.
